Overview

Underground Blossom is an adventure game that invites players to explore the Rusty Lake Underground while navigating through Laura Vanderboom's life and memories The game offers a unique point-and-click puzzle experience where players must solve various challenges at each metro station to uncover Laura's story and help her escape the corruption within her mind With its atmospheric soundtrack and intriguing storyline Underground Blossom provides an engaging experience for fans of mystery and puzzle games The estimated playtime is around 2 hours making it suitable for both casual and dedicated gamers who enjoy narrative-driven adventures

Features

Underground Blossom stands out as a captivating adventure game with numerous features Here are five notable aspects 1 A Gripping Storyline - Players embark on a journey through Laura Vanderboom's life memories and potential futures Each metro station represents a distinct chapter in her story offering a rich narrative experience 2 Challenging Puzzles - The game presents a variety of puzzles that require logical thinking and exploration Solving these puzzles helps progress through the stations and reveals hidden secrets 3 Unique Metro Stations - Travel to seven distinct metro stations each designed with its own theme and atmosphere These locations provide diverse environments for players to explore 4 Atmospheric Soundtrack - Victor Butzelaar's music enhances the gaming experience with an evocative soundtrack featuring a cello performance by Sebastiaan van Halsema 5 Achievements System - Players can earn achievements by discovering secrets and completing challenges adding an extra layer of engagement and replayability

Narrative depth & character engagement

In the realm of adventure games narrative depth and character engagement play pivotal roles in creating an immersive experience. Underground Blossom excels in these aspects by weaving a compelling story around Laura Vanderboom as players traverse through her life and memories via different metro stations. Each station not only represents a physical location within the game but also symbolizes a significant period or event in Laura's existence. This clever intertwining of setting with personal history enriches the narrative making every puzzle solved and every discovery made feel impactful. The game invites players to piece together Laura's fragmented past and uncertain future fostering a deep connection with her character. As users navigate this intricate storyline they are not merely passive observers but active participants unraveling mysteries that hold the key to Laura's mental liberation. This level of engagement ensures that players remain invested in Laura's journey eagerly piecing together clues to help her escape the corruption plaguing her mind.
